  • Page 8 STUMP GRINDER LIMITED WARRANTY J.P. Carlton Co. Inc., hereafter referred to as the “Manufacturer”, warrants each new Carlton Grinder to be free of defects in workmanship and material for a period of one year. This warranty takes effect upon delivery to the original retail purchaser. The manufacturer, at its option, will replace or repair, at a point designated by the manufacturer, any parts which appear to have been defective in material or workmanship.
  • Page 9 The manufacturer will provide replacement parts at no cost to the customer for defective parts during the warranty period. Defective parts must be returned to J.P. Carlton Company. It will be the customers’ responsibility to install the replacement parts unless arrangements are made with the selling dealer.

  • Page 42 SP7015 MACHINE MAINTENANCE BELTS • Check belt tension (Daily). Inspect for wear and alignment (Monthly). For details on replacing belts, see Servicing Belts section of this manual. NOTICE Tension on newly installed belts drops rapidly during the first hours of operation. Check and adjust frequently during the first 24 hours.
  • Page 43 SP7015 MACHINE MAINTENANCE CHECK FOR WEAR • Inspect belts, sheaves and/or sprockets for wear. See illustrations to assist with inspection. For details on replacing belts, see Servicing Belts section of this manual. • V-Belt-drive efficiency depends on full contact between the belt and the sheave walls.

  • Page 54 SP7015 SERVICING CUTTER WHEEL TOOTH SHARPENING • Begin by chamfering shank back past edge of carbide. You do this because if it is not back far enough the shank will hit the stump instead of the carbide, thus causing a lot of vibration.

  • Page 63 SP7015 SERVICING BEARINGS SERVICING TURNTABLE BEARING While turntable bearings require almost no attention, what little they are given will pay big dividends in long life, high performance, and trouble-free service. Lubricate the bearing every 100 operating hours for relatively slow rotating applications. Idle equipment should not be neglected.
